17 小时以前 347cc8cf56e67ce1d71569863befa87ad19b1312
feat(approve): 添加销售台账ID字段支持

- 在ApproveProcess实体类中新增salesLedgerId字段并配置表映射
- 在审批流程服务实现中设置销售台账ID的赋值逻辑
- 确保文件查询时使用正确的销售台账ID关联数据
已修改2个文件
5 ■■■■■ 文件已修改
src/main/java/com/ruoyi/approve/pojo/ApproveProcess.java 4 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/approve/service/impl/ApproveProcessServiceImpl.java 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/ruoyi/approve/pojo/ApproveProcess.java
@@ -177,6 +177,10 @@
    @ApiModelProperty(value = "销售单号")
    private String salesContractNo;
    @TableField(exist = false)
    @ApiModelProperty(value = "销售台账id")
    private Long salesLedgerId;
    @ApiModelProperty(value = "创建用户")
    @TableField(fill = FieldFill.INSERT)
src/main/java/com/ruoyi/approve/service/impl/ApproveProcessServiceImpl.java
@@ -205,6 +205,7 @@
                        allFiles = commonFileMapper.selectList(new LambdaQueryWrapper<CommonFile>()
                                .eq(CommonFile::getCommonId, shippingInfo.getSalesLedgerId())
                                .eq(CommonFile::getType, FileNameType.SALE.getValue()));
                        record.setSalesLedgerId(shippingInfo.getSalesLedgerId());
                    }
                }
            }